Crocs Inc
CONSUMER CYCLICAL · FOOTWEAR & ACCESSORIES · USA
Crocs, Inc. designs, develops, manufactures, markets and distributes casual lifestyle footwear and accessories for men, women and children. The company is headquartered in Broomfield, Colorado.
Nike Inc
CONSUMER CYCLICAL · FOOTWEAR & ACCESSORIES · USA
Nike, Inc. is an American multinational corporation that is engaged in the design, development, manufacturing, and worldwide marketing and sales of footwear, apparel, equipment, accessories, and services. The company is headquartered near Beaverton, Oregon, in the Portland metropolitan area. It is the world's largest supplier of athletic shoes and apparel and a major manufacturer of sports equipment.
